Try the install again, and read the logs as the install is running.
On the server, the file you need to watch (I usually use "tail -f" before clicking on the action that is failing) is <jira home>/logs/atlassian-jira.log

You don't need to uninstall the product to update your licenses, just go to my atlassian and get the license keys and change them in your environment by going to "Applications".
But for your case, as there was a tool version update, I faced something similar and it was because we were using insight and he made a change in the database.
Had to contact Atlassian support to resolve.
To help, create a support zip log file.
Go to "System";
Click on "Troubleshooting and support tools";
Then click on "Create support zip", and then on "Create Zip".
Jira will give you a complete log file that can be useful for Atlassian staff to help you with.
Having the file, contact the staff here: https://support.atlassian.com/contact/#/
Sometimes some apps make changes to the database and version updates are impacted with these apps
